Occurrences like that happen often in the fashion industry. For insurance, a  real case that shaped the dupe debate was the gucci/guess debacle.

Gucci v. Guess? (S.D.N.Y. 2012)

Gucci sued Guess for producing accessories with a diamond-pattern print and interlocking-G design that Gucci argued mimicked its iconic monogram. The court awarded Gucci $4.7 million in damages — a landmark case establishing how seriously courts take trade dress and trademark infringement in fashion accessories.

The Gucci vs Guess Case really shows how much dupes affect the emotions of the original creator of a product. Guess’s alleged mimicking of Gucci’s iconic design was something personal.
